Output 2954ecedd563087323e23f62157a75cf8bff7ded6d69cd64f04479a2b54e97a2:1

value
23559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950ebc2922052c2ac3a17a9a52f792d5b7809732 OP_EQUAL
address
3FHAFw2udQz27AbNrJ6RFf6dmYURiLXY9c
transaction
2954ecedd563087323e23f62157a75cf8bff7ded6d69cd64f04479a2b54e97a2
spent
true